Cleaning the cooling module

The following information is dependent on if access to the cooling
module is available. Access is available on certain models only.

If you use the computer for a long period, the inside of the computer
may become hot. Always allow the computer to cool to room
temperature before you clean the cooling module.

To clean the cooling module, follow the steps detailed below:

1

Shut down the computer and make sure the Power indicator is
off (refer to

“Turning off the computer” on page 76

in the

Getting Started chapter, if necessary).

2

Remove the AC adaptor and all cables and peripherals
connected to the computer.

3

Close the display panel and turn the computer upside down.

4

Remove the battery pack (refer to

“Removing the battery from

the computer” on page 117

in the Mobile Computing chapter,

if necessary).

5

Depending on your model, use either a thin-tipped tool to push
the hole at the edge of the cooling module cover, or a
screwdriver to remove the screw, and then slide the cover in the
direction of the arrow to remove it.
